免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发软件专家

App开发软件是指用于开发移动应用程序的软件工具和平台。它们提供了一系列的功能和工具,使开发者能够创建、测试和发布应用程序。在这篇文章中,我将详细介绍一些常用的App开发软件,并解释它们的原理和功能。

1. Android Studio:Android Studio是一个由谷歌开发的集成开发环境(IDE),用于开发Android应用程序。它基于IntelliJ IDEA开发,提供了丰富的功能和工具,包括代码编辑器、调试器、布局编辑器和性能分析器等。Android Studio使用Java或Kotlin编程语言,支持各种Android设备和版本。

2. Xcode:Xcode是苹果公司开发的IDE,用于开发iOS和macOS应用程序。它提供了一个完整的开发环境,包括代码编辑器、界面设计器、调试器和性能分析器等。Xcode使用Objective-C或Swift编程语言,支持各种苹果设备和版本。

3. Visual Studio:Visual Studio是微软公司开发的IDE,用于开发各种应用程序,包括Windows应用程序、Web应用程序和移动应用程序等。它提供了强大的代码编辑器、调试器、界面设计器和测试工具等。Visual Studio支持多种编程语言,如C#、C++和JavaScript等。

4. Flutter:Flutter是谷歌开发的移动应用程序开发框架,用于跨平台应用程序开发。它使用Dart编程语言,并提供了丰富的UI组件和工具,可以快速构建高性能、美观的应用程序。Flutter具有热重载功能,可以实时预览和调试应用程序的变化。

5. React Native:React Native是Facebook开发的移动应用程序开发框架,用于跨平台应用程序开发。它使用JavaScript编程语言,并基于React框架构建用户界面。React Native提供了一套丰富的组件和API,可以快速开发高质量的应用程序,并实现原生的用户体验。

以上是一些常用的App开发软件,它们在不同的平台和场景中发挥着重要的作用。它们提供了丰富的功能和工具,使开发者能够快速、高效地开发应用程序。无论是初学者还是有经验的开发者,都可以通过使用这些软件来实现自己的创意和构建优秀的应用程序。希望本文对你有所帮助!


相关知识:
如何开发一个新的app
开发一个新的app需要经过多个步骤,包括需求分析、界面设计、编程实现、测试和发布。下面将分别介绍每个步骤的原理和详细过程。一、需求分析在开发一个新的app之前,我们需要先了解用户的需求,确定app的功能和特性。需求分析是app开发的第一步,它包括以下几个方
2024-01-10
cfsp系统app开发
CFSP系统(Content Filtering and Security Policy)是一种用于保护网络安全的系统,它主要用于过滤和监控互联网上的内容,以防止非法和有害的信息传播。在本文中,我将为您介绍CFSP系统的原理和详细开发过程。CFSP系统的原
2023-07-14
app开发缓存图片
在 app 开发中,常常需要加载大量的图片资源,为了减少用户等待时间,提升用户体验,缓存图片已成为 app 开发的一个重要优化手段。### 缓存图片的原理缓存图片的原理就是将图片下载到本地存储,下次需要使用该图片时直接从本地获取。这样可以避免每次加载图片时
2023-06-29
app开发机
APP(Application,即Application Software)又称为移动应用、手机应用,是指在移动设备上运行的软件程序。随着智能手机、平板电脑等移动设备的普及,APP的开发已经成为一个热门的技术领域。APP开发机是指用于APP开发的软件和硬件
2023-06-29
app程序开发定制台州
移动应用程序的开发是现代科技领域中最热门的领域之一。当今移动应用市场的需求非常高,随着技术的不断发展,各种不同类型的应用层出不穷。在这个市场中,应用定制是一项非常重要的服务。本文将介绍在台州地区的移动应用程序开发定制服务。一、移动应用程序开发定制的概念移动
2023-05-06
apple 个人开发者 免费
自2013年起,苹果公司推出了个人开发者免费计划,允许任何人以非商业目的创建应用程序,无需支付开发者年费。这对于想要进入应用开发领域的个人开发者来说是一个非常有吸引力的政策。在此免费计划下,开发者可以在苹果公司的App Store中出售应用程序,并获得70
2023-05-06